My daughter Kelly has had a year of trials and pain. But is now on the journey of healing and restoration. In high school she was diagnosed with dystonia. It runs in the family in various degrees, from simple writers cramp and eye blinking to severe uncontrollable muscular spasms. Luckily at first she had some light movements and the writers cramp and it stayed that way until after turning 24, it began to progress rapidly and in July of 2011 she was forced to quit her job and to no longer drive.

It got so bad that they rushed her schedule to get her in for Deep Brain Stimulation surgeries. On September 15 she had the first of two surgeries. This one to implant the electrodes into her brain, and a week later they placed the two pacemakers that would control the implants.

One month later after some struggles with medication and pain control, she went in for initial programming. They turned them on and made some adjustments. Improvement is a slow patient process of making slight changes monthly and she has shown improvements almost every visit.
